X Graphic does NOT change ground scenery. It allows you to customize the LOOK of your sim by changing various 'things', such as:
Sky textures, water textures, cloud texture, airport textures, lights, sounds, and sun textures as well as having a basic weather engine (Visibility transitions).

Ultimate Terrain X, does something completely diferant. It makes the scenery more accurate to real life by adding scenery for, Highways, Roads, Streets, Shorelines, Coastlines, Rivers, Streams, Landclass, Waterclass, Railroads, Night Lighting, Object Repositioning, and some textures. None of which Active Sky X does.

Two different products doing two completely diferant things. X Graphics does NOT change mesh, it changes TEXTURES, CLOUD textures. There are cloud resolution settings that you can choose... obviously the higher the more realistic, more detailed the clouds look.

Ultimate Terrain X barely touches ground textures, therefore it's recommended you set the Texture resolution to 1m (default)... MESH resolution of UTX is 19m, default is something like 38m for USA. GEX should be overwriding all ground TEXTURES that UTX changes, anyway.

The jaggies have got nothing to do with either addon and don't have anything to do with texture resolution or mesh. A pixel can only display one colour at a time, and with objects at an angle, it creates jagged 'steps' on the edges. A counter to this is Anti-Aliasing which more or less blurs edge.

It's probably better to force anti-aliasing through your videodrivers, if that doesn't work due to horrible (nvidia) drivers, you can try diferant versions or just turn Anti-Aliasing on in fsx display settings.
